Some aspects of heavy particle stripping in low-lying levels of 10B
Description
The heavy-particle stripping and the deuteron stripping contributions have been separated in the neutron yield corresponding to the ground state and the 0.72, 1.75, 2.20, 2.86 and 3.69 states of 10B. The 2.86 MeV neutrons are predominantly produced from heavy-particle stripping while 3.69 MeV neutrons are produced almost entirely from deuteron stripping process. Interference effects are likely to lead to overlapping of both these states resulting in evidence for only the higher energy level, the 2.86 MeV states escaping detection. (author)
